Basic Quad J-Type Analog Thermocouple Amplifier
SEN-30103-J1
Analog thermocouple amplifier board based on the AD849x from Analog Devices (successor of the AD597). This quad-channel thermocouple board converts the very low voltage signal from a thermocouple to a highly-linear, 0.005V/C output with either 0V or 1.245V offset (both configurations stocked) while removing unwanted noise from the signal. Many supply and output configurations are available with this board, though the PCB was designed with Arduino in mind. Specifically, the output header will plug directly into a standard Arduino Uno or Mega, with a pin-for-pin match for power supply, ground and analog outputs. With a 5V Arduino, temperatures from 0C to 1,000C are possible with the 0V offset board and -249C to 750C with the 1.245V offset board. If using a 3.3V microcontroller (Due, etc), the board must be supplied with no more than 3.3V to avoid damaging the microcontroller. Temperature measurement range is dependent on the supply voltage. It is possible to supply the board with higher voltages to allow temperature measurement over the entire operating range of the K-Type and J-Type thermocouples, allowing use with more capable data acquisition equipment.

Finite Element Method Magnetics Simulation Software
FEMM
Finite Element Method Magnetics
FEMM is a suite of programs for solving low frequency electro magnetic problems on two-dimensional planar and axisymmetric domains. The program currently addresses linear/nonlinear magneto-static problems, linear/nonlinear time harmonic magnetic problems, linear electrostatic problems, and steady-state heat flow problems.

Load Cell Simulators / Testers
A load cell simulator is a handy tool during initial setup, particularly of a batching by weight scale. It replaces the load cell(s) in the system allowing the scale technician to simulate various weights that will trigger the outputs setpoints for activating valves, gates, and mixers. These products are a must for anyone involved in scale installations and repairs.

Steady-state Solar Simulator For PV Modules
SORAS LS
In certification laboratories for photovoltaic modules, steady-state solar simulators are mostly used for stabilization / light soaking tests (MQT 19) and hot-spot endurance tests (MQT 09) according to IEC 61215 and IEC 61730. An initial stabilization is required for all PV modules that undergo a standard test procedure. For the hot-spot endurance test (MQT 09), it is important that the operator has easy access to the front and back site of the module. During the test, it is necessary to shade one cell after each other to take infrared pictures, which requires good visibility of the entire back side.
